Magnetic putty provides a visual and interactive way to show how certain materials respond to a magnetic field. When a strong magnet is brought close to the putty, the magnetic particles inside the putty may react by slowly moving, stretching, or pulling toward the magnet, helping students understand magnetic force and ferromagnetic material behavior.

How to Use

  1. Open the container and take a small amount of magnetic putty on a clean, dry, non-porous surface.
  2. Stretch, roll, or shape the putty gently to observe its flexible material properties.
  3. Place a strong magnet near the putty without forcing direct contact at first.
  4. Observe how the putty slowly moves, stretches, or pulls toward the magnet.
  5. Change the distance between the magnet and the putty to compare magnetic force strength.
  6. Move the magnet around different sides of the putty to observe direction changes.
  7. Compare the reaction with ordinary putty or non-magnetic classroom materials if available.
  8. Record observations such as movement speed, attraction direction, shape change, and distance effect.
  9. Discuss how ferromagnetic particles respond to magnetic fields.
  10. After the activity, return the putty to its container and close the lid properly.
  11. Wash hands after handling and clean the working surface if required.
